Metoda Source.CommentSpan —
Komentarze określony zakres źródłowy.
Przestrzeń nazw: Microsoft.VisualStudio.Package
Zestawy: Microsoft.VisualStudio.Package.LanguageService.10.0 (w Microsoft.VisualStudio.Package.LanguageService.10.0.dll)
Microsoft.VisualStudio.Package.LanguageService (w Microsoft.VisualStudio.Package.LanguageService.dll)
Microsoft.VisualStudio.Package.LanguageService.11.0 (w Microsoft.VisualStudio.Package.LanguageService.11.0.dll)
Microsoft.VisualStudio.Package.LanguageService.9.0 (w Microsoft.VisualStudio.Package.LanguageService.9.0.dll)
Składnia
'Deklaracja
Public Overridable Function CommentSpan ( _
span As TextSpan _
) As TextSpan
public virtual TextSpan CommentSpan(
TextSpan span
)
Parametry
- span
Typ: Microsoft.VisualStudio.TextManager.Interop.TextSpan
A TextSpan obiekt zakresu źródłowego do komentarz opisujący.
Wartość zwracana
Typ: Microsoft.VisualStudio.TextManager.Interop.TextSpan
Nowy TextSpan obiekt obejmujący cały komentarzem, span, włączając wszelkie początku komentarza i zakończyć ciągi.
Uwagi
Metoda ta określa, w jaki sposób najlepiej przy dokonywaniu wyboru między linii i blok komentarzy w komentarz zakresu, a następnie wywołuje CommentBlock lub CommentLines metody na zakres.Wywołanie GetCommentFormat metoda uzyskiwania ciągów, które definiują komentarz.
Wywołania metody podstawowej GetCommentFormat metody i wywołania CommentLines metodę, jeśli zostanie określony ciąg komentarza wiersza; w przeciwnym razie zwraca CommentBlock metodę, jeśli są określone ciągi blok komentarza.Uwaga to podejście zawsze używa wiersz komentarze Jeśli zarówno wiersz komentarza i blok uwag ciągi są określone--nawet wtedy, gdy zmieniamy bloku tekstu.
Metoda ta jest zwykle wywoływana w odpowiedzi na polecenie użytkownika Zaznaczenie komentarza z Zaawansowane menu Edytuj menu.
Zobacz Kod komentowania (pakiet zarządzanych ramy) więcej informacji na temat tej metody jest używany.
Zabezpieczenia programu .NET Framework
- Pełne zaufanie do bezpośredniego wywołującego. Tego elementu członkowskiego nie można używać w kodzie częściowo zaufanym. Aby uzyskać więcej informacji, zobacz Przy użyciu bibliotek z częściowo zaufanego kodu..
Zobacz też
Informacje
Przestrzeń nazw Microsoft.VisualStudio.Package